3. Dental Implants
Dental implants are the most credible way of replacing lost teeth. The oral surgeons implant titanium into the jawbone so that it can accept support crowns which will look like anything real.

5.Corrective Jaw Surgery
Jaw surgery is performed for correcting bite problems, jaw misalignment, or the TMJ pain that most patients suffer with chronically.

7. Facial Trauma Treatment
Injuries or accidents could lead to fractures of the face, jaws, and teeth. This is a special kind of surgical treatment that regains normal function and aesthetics.
